Social Services Director - Nursing Home jobs in Portland, OR

Social Services Director - Nursing Home in a nursing home environment, directs, establishes, and plans the overall policies and goals for the social services department. Responsible for patient assessments, care planning and helping the patients and families adjust to their new surroundings or occupations. Being a Social Services Director - Nursing Home plans and administers social service programs. Supervises the facility's social workers. Additionally, Social Services Director - Nursing Home assists in development of policies regarding participation in facility planning for health and welfare services. Requires a master's degree. Typically reports to top management. The Social Services Director - Nursing Home typically manages through subordinate managers and professionals in larger groups of moderate complexity. Provides input to strategic decisions that affect the functional area of responsibility. May give input into developing the budget. Capable of resolving escalated issues arising from operations and requiring coordination with other departments. To be a Social Services Director - Nursing Home typically requires 3+ years of managerial experience. (Copyright 2024 Salary.com)

Director of Clinical Services
  • Amedisys Home Health Services
  • Portland, OR FULL_TIME
  • Overview

    Directs clinical services and is accountable for adherence to federal, state and local laws, accreditation, and company policies and standards for patient care services. Accountable for measuring, monitoring, and managing quality of patient care, achievement of key performance indicators and organizational clinical performance. Provides supervision to the clinical manager(s) who ensure the delivery of quality care to patients.

    Responsibilities

    • Ensures the care center's compliance with all regulations, laws, policies and procedures. Educates all staff members about state, federal, and accreditation requirements (as applicable). Maintains compliance with all local, state and federal laws regarding licensure and certification of care center personnel and accreditation standards.
    • Ensures a multi-disciplinary approach to patient care is maintained that assesses and identifies all patient needs and communicates that need to the designated Clinical Manager, primary nurse or clinician and/or the patient's physician.
    • Oversees and directs the activities of the Clinical Manager and Intake Coordinator in the provision and coordination of patient care.
    • Implements/maintains appropriate clinician staffing levels. Ensures clinician productivity standards are met.
    • Oversees the weekly Patient Care Conference and assures participation of all clinical staff. Ensures Patient Care Conference policy and protocols are followed.
    • Responsible for the implementation of the care centers professional and clinical services, and performance improvement programs.
    • Promotes and maintains standards for providing quality patient care by all staff of the care center.
    • May function as Agency Administrator.
    • Ensures Clinical Manager, clinician orientation and trainings occur per company standards.
    • Provides oversight of the Performance Improvement Program and assures completion of the documentation for tracking and trending reports, i.e. infection control, complaints and occurrences.
    • Provides oversight of and/or administers annual skills competency evaluation.
    • Serves as a member of the Professional Advisory Committee and Performance Improvement Committee.
    • Adheres to company policies and procedures and HIPAA/ Privacy Program, Compliance Program, and Code of Conduct and Ethics.
    • Collaborates with Area Vice President of Clinical Operations in implementation of clinical operations, standards, and processes.
    • Monitors and evaluates employee performance. Holds employees accountable for the attainment of defined goals and objectives. Executes effective performance redirection when needed. Develops employees through coaching, mentoring, and formal/on the job training and development opportunities.
    • Performs other duties as assigned.

    Qualifications

    Required

    • Associate or bachelor's degree in Nursing
    • Current, unencumbered license to practice as a Registered Nurse specific to that state the employee is assigned to work by the company
    • Two (2 ) years of RN experience in a home health or hospice environment
    • Three (3 ) years' experience in clinical leadership / management in health care, home health or hospice
    • Current CPR certification

Portland is the largest and most populous city in the U.S. state of Oregon and the seat of Multnomah County. It is a major port in the Willamette Valley region of the Pacific Northwest, at the confluence of the Willamette and Columbia rivers. As of 2017, Portland had an estimated population of 647,805, making it the 26th-largest city in the United States, and the second-most populous in the Pacific Northwest (after Seattle).
